>> newSelectionRanges on its own wouldn't be as useful as possible, since
>> it tells you nothing about the selection direction. You could cover
>> this by adding newSelectionFocusNode, newSelectionFocusOffset,
>> newSelectionAnchorNode and newSelectionAnchorOffset as well.
>>
>
> Could we just put a Selection object on the event? That way, if we add new
> fields to Selections, we won't need to add new fields to the selectstart
> event.
>

Should we support methods such as modify, collapse, setPosition?
